          SB 183-ABANDONED VEHICLES; PRIVATE PROPERTY                                                                       
                                                                                                                                
3:34:03 PM                                                                                                                    
CHAIR REVAK announced  the consideration of SENATE  BILL NO. 183,                                                               
"An Act relating to vehicles abandoned on private property."                                                                    
                                                                                                                                
[The committee adopted the committee  substitute (CS) for SB 183,                                                               
version M, during the 3/5/20 hearing.]                                                                                          
                                                                                                                                
CHAIR  REVAK noted  that  this  was the  second  hearing and  the                                                               
sponsor provided answers to questions previously asked.                                                                         
                                                                                                                                
3:34:34 PM                                                                                                                    
SENATOR JESSE  KIEHL, Alaska  State Legislature,  Juneau, Alaska,                                                               
speaking as  the sponsor,  stated that SB  183 shortens  the time                                                               
that private property owners must  wait before starting the legal                                                               
process to gain title and  dispose of vehicles abandoned on their                                                               
property.  Affected property  owners must  provide notice  to the                                                               
last  owner of  record and  any  lienholders in  order to  obtain                                                               
title to any abandoned vehicles.                                                                                                
                                                                                                                                
3:35:29 PM                                                                                                                    
CHAIR REVAK opened public testimony  on SB 183; after determining                                                               
that no one  wished to testify, he closed public  testimony on SB
183.                                                                                                                            
                                                                                                                                
3:36:07 PM                                                                                                                    
SENATOR  COGHILL moved  to report  the committee  substitute (CS)                                                               
for  SB   183,  work  order  31-LS0587\M,   from  committee  with                                                               
individual recommendations and attached fiscal note.                                                                            
                                                                                                                                
CHAIR REVAK  found no  objection and  CSSB 183(STA)  was reported                                                               
from the Senate State Affairs Standing Committee.
